The Clinical Course of COVID-19 Pneumonia in a 19-Year-Old Man on Intravenous Immunoglobulin Replacement Therapy for X-Linked Agammaglobulinemia

Table 2. Patient’s initial blood work at the time of COVID-19 diagnosis.
| Laboratory test | Result | Reference range |
|---|---|---|
| White blood count | 9.9×10/L | 4.0–11.0×10/L |
| Hemoglobin | 14.5 g/dL | 11.5–16.5 g/dL |
| Platelet | 325×10/L | 150–450×10/L |
| Neutrophil count | 6.8×10/L | 2–7.5×10/L |
| Lymphocyte count | 2.15×10/L | 1.5–4×10/L |
| C-reactive protein | 47.6 mg/L | 0–5 mg/L |
| Erythrocyte sedimentation rate | 43 mm/h | 0–20 mm/h |
| Ferritin | 58 ug/L | 11–313 ug/L |
| Procalcitonin | 0.05 ug/L | ≥0.25 ug/L |
| Lactate dehydrogenase | 305 U/L | 100–217 U/L |
| D-dimer | 0.78 mg/L | 0–0.5 mg/L |
